As generative AI continues to revolutionize industries, organizations are eager to integrate this transformative technology into their operations. While the temptation to have in-house IT teams build custom AI solutions is strong—especially when those teams are enthusiastic about "learning on the fly"—this approach can lead to significant pitfalls. Hidden complexities in data management, security, reporting, cost control, governance, and more can turn well-intentioned projects into costly misadventures.
The Allure of In-House Development
Empowering internal IT teams to develop AI solutions seems advantageous:
- Cost Savings: Avoiding vendor fees and licensing costs.
- Customization: Tailoring solutions to specific business needs.
- Skill Development: Enhancing the team's expertise and capabilities.
However, these perceived benefits often overshadow the risks and challenges inherent in building AI systems without adequate experience.
Hidden Complexities That Can Derail Projects
1. Data Management Nightmares
Volume and Variety: AI systems require vast amounts of data. Managing large datasets, especially unstructured data, demands robust infrastructure and expertise.
Data Quality: Poor-quality data leads to inaccurate models. Gartner estimates that poor data quality costs organizations an average of $12.9 million annually1.
Data Integration: Combining data from disparate sources is complex. Inconsistent formats and siloed databases can hinder AI development.
2. Security Vulnerabilities
Data Breaches: Handling sensitive data increases the risk of breaches. According to IBM, the average cost of a data breach in 2023 was $4.45 million2.
Compliance Issues: Regulations like GDPR and CCPA impose strict data handling requirements. Non-compliance can result in hefty fines.
Model Security: AI models themselves can be targets for attacks like adversarial examples or model inversion.
3. Inadequate Reporting and Explainability
Black Box Models: AI systems, especially deep learning models, can be opaque. This lack of transparency complicates decision-making and accountability.
Regulatory Compliance: Industries like finance and healthcare require explainable AI for compliance. Failing to provide adequate reporting can lead to legal issues.
User Trust: Stakeholders may distrust AI outputs without clear explanations, reducing adoption and effectiveness.
4. Uncontrolled Costs
Overruns: Projects often exceed budgets. A study by McKinsey found that 17% of IT projects go so badly that they threaten the existence of the company3.
Hidden Expenses: Costs for cloud computing, data storage, and talent acquisition can escalate quickly.
Maintenance: Ongoing support and updates add to the total cost of ownership, often underestimated in initial planning.
5. Governance Gaps
Lack of Policies: Without established AI governance frameworks, projects can drift without clear objectives or oversight.
Ethical Considerations: Issues like bias and fairness require careful governance. A lack of attention here can lead to public relations crises.
Strategic Alignment: Projects may not align with business goals, leading to wasted resources.
6. Talent Shortages and Skill Gaps
Specialized Expertise Needed: AI development requires skills in machine learning, data science, and software engineering.
Learning Curve: Allowing teams to "learn on the fly" delays project timelines. According to a report by O'Reilly, only 15% of companies consider themselves mature in AI practices4.
Turnover Risks: Investing in training can be lost if employees leave, taking their newfound expertise elsewhere.
Real-World Consequences
Case Study: Financial Firm's Costly Misstep
A mid-sized financial services company decided to develop an AI-powered risk assessment tool in-house. The IT team, eager to build their skills, embarked on the project with minimal prior AI experience.
- Delays: The project took 18 months longer than planned.
- Budget Overrun: Costs exceeded the initial budget by 200%.
- Compliance Failures: The tool did not meet regulatory requirements for explainability, resulting in a $1 million fine.
- Security Breach: A lack of proper security measures led to a data breach affecting 10,000 clients.
Survey Insights
A survey by Gartner revealed that 85% of AI projects fail to deliver on their objectives due to issues like data quality, lack of expertise, and poorly defined use cases5.
The Advantages of Leveraging Established Platforms
Expertise and Support
Platforms come with:
- Pre-built Models: Tested and optimized algorithms.
- Technical Support: Access to experts who can assist with implementation and troubleshooting.
- Continuous Learning: Platforms update regularly to incorporate the latest advancements.
Robust Security and Compliance
- Data Protection: Advanced encryption and security protocols.
- Regulatory Compliance: Adherence to industry standards and regulations.
- Audit Trails: Comprehensive logging for accountability.
Scalability and Flexibility
- Resource Management: Scale computing resources up or down as needed.
- Integration Capabilities: Easily connect with existing systems and databases.
- Customization Options: Configure solutions to meet specific needs without starting from scratch.
Cost Predictability
- Transparent Pricing: Clear subscription models and usage fees.
- Reduced Overheads: Lower maintenance and operational costs.
- ROI Tracking: Tools to monitor performance and returns.
Mitigating Risks When Building In-House
If an organization still opts for in-house development, mitigating strategies include:
- Pilot Programs: Start with small, manageable projects to build experience.
- Hybrid Approaches: Combine in-house efforts with platform services.
- Training and Development: Invest in comprehensive training for the IT team.
- Consulting Services: Hire external experts to guide the project.
Conclusion
While the ambition to build custom AI solutions in-house is commendable, the hidden complexities and risks often outweigh the benefits. Data management challenges, security vulnerabilities, reporting inadequacies, cost overruns, governance issues, and talent gaps can derail projects and result in significant financial and reputational damage.
Leveraging established AI platforms mitigates these risks by providing expertise, robust infrastructure, security, compliance, and scalability. This allows organizations to focus on their core competencies and strategic objectives rather than reinventing the wheel.
In the rapidly evolving landscape of AI, time is of the essence. Organizations that recognize the pitfalls of "learning on the fly" and opt for more secure, efficient solutions will be better positioned to succeed and thrive.
Footnotes
- Gartner. (2021). How to Create a Business Case for Data Quality Improvement. Retrieved from Gartner ↩
- IBM Security. (2023). Cost of a Data Breach Report 2023. Retrieved from IBM ↩
- McKinsey & Company. (2012). Delivering large-scale IT projects on time, on budget, and on value. Retrieved from McKinsey ↩
- O'Reilly Media. (2020). AI Adoption in the Enterprise 2020. Retrieved from O'Reilly ↩
- Gartner. (2019). Gartner Survey Shows 37 Percent of Organizations Have Implemented AI. Retrieved from Gartner ↩